Latest Patents

Clapperton holds a patent for a "Temperature sensor assembly for swirling flows." This invention includes a bluff body and a first member that is spaced apart from the bluff body, defining a first flow channel. Additionally, a second member is also spaced apart from the bluff body, creating a second flow channel. The design further incorporates a third flow channel that is in fluid communication with the first and second flow channels. A sensor element is strategically placed within the third flow channel, allowing for accurate temperature measurements.
